Our Solution
We grow mycelium (mushroom root networks) on paddy straw and agricultural waste. The result: packaging that's custom-shaped, shock-absorbent, fire-resistant, and fully biodegradable. Made in India, for India.
Breaks down in soil within 30โ60 days. No landfills, no microplastics, zero pollution.
First-of-its-kind direct extrusion technology. Custom shapes & complex geometries without molds โ a breakthrough in manufacturing flexibility.
Flame-resistant, turns to ash reusable as natural pigment. Safer, custom-fit alternative to Styrofoam for electronics and premium goods.
Our Process
Optimized paddy straw processing with controlled sterilization protocols.
Engineered particle size distribution with moisture optimization for printability.
Proprietary paste loading into modified extrusion-based 3D printing platform.
Controlled printing with integrated incubation for mycelial growth and binding.
Dual-process hardening (air-drying/thermal) for desired strength characteristics.

Competitive Landscape
| Company | Value Proposition | Material Source | Customizability | Innovation / IP |
|---|---|---|---|---|
| ๐ฑ Nivraa | India-native, 3D-printable mycelium using local agri-waste | Local agri-waste + mushroom spawn (India) | High โ paste enables smooth, hollow, detailed 3D forms | Patentable 3D printing process (pending) |
| Ecovative (US) | Global pioneer in scalable mycelium biomaterials | Agricultural waste (US) | High โ moldable into any shape | 40+ patents |
| Roha.bio (India) | Biodegradable, 1st in Indian Mycelium Packaging | Agro-industrial residue (India) | High โ design-led, mold-based | Licensed Ecovative tech |
| Grown.bio (EU) | EU sustainable packaging supplier | Local agro-waste (Netherlands) | LowโModerate โ basic shapes | Limited |
| Thermocol (EPS) | Cheap, mass-produced but highly polluting | Fossil-fuel polystyrene | Low | None |
